Yes. Generally, people run a 245. Many people tried 255s over the years, and it wasn't faster.
I actually ran a 255 Yokohama A052 last year at Nationals, because it was all I could get at that time. It wasn't terrible. I'm using a 245 Yokohama this year. On 17 x 9 RPF1s, I measured the mounted section width of my 245 RE-71R and compared it to the Yokohama 245 A052. They were the same. Sent from my SM-G930P using Tapatalk |
